Transaction 64f157d6c788856e544197285d36e849676897372748d281fac06e0a19f441e8

5 Input
2 Outputs
  • 64f157d6c788856e544197285d36e849676897372748d281fac06e0a19f441e8:0
  • value  79300000
    address  17Rts5k1WBWJTM8TFv2FeSGTyCATyQZLb6
  • 64f157d6c788856e544197285d36e849676897372748d281fac06e0a19f441e8:1
  • value  44427354
    address  1B9ojK9QJ6M9CCDP1TTKz7bKYqYimK4Ksr